Choosing the Perfect Winter Wedding Colors

Do you love snow and want to incorporate it into your wedding? There’s no better time to do so than in winter. The rich colors of the season make it an excellent time for weddings. Wedding color palettes can be a difficult choice for many brides and the numerous choices available can leave you feeling overwhelmed. Fortunately, there are many excellent options for winter wedding colors. They help set different moods and allow you to create the perfect winter wonderland.

Choosing the Perfect Winter Wedding Colors 

Red and White

Red and white is a classic winter combination

Red is a popular winter color that looks stunning when paired with white. These two colors recall the best parts of winter: Christmas and Valentine’s Day. They evoke a mood of romance and pure happiness and make a perfect match for winter weddings. You can create unique looks with these colors by mixing up prints like stripes, checks, and toile. For an elegant look, layer different shades of white and red. You can choose shades which range from bright pink to purple. These colors create a striking effect against a white wedding gown.

Black, White, and Green

Black, white, and green looks fresh and modern

Punctuate a black and white theme with dashes of green. This color combination oozes contemporary style and recalls a forest filled with snow. It is also masculine and is ideal for brides who want to keep their grooms involved. To keep the look elegant and sophisticated, use crisp white and black décor pieces and add green sparingly to your floral arrangements or your bouquet. Use prints to highlight the contrast between white and black.

White, Silver, and Blue

White, silver, and blue create a winter wonderland

If you want a contemporary take on a winter wonderland, this theme is the way to go. You can add some sparkle to the palette with sparkling crystals, mercury glass, or antique glitter. For an elegant and sophisticated combination, integrate bare winter branches to the décor.

When it comes to setting the tone for your big day, the color palette is one of the most crucial things. Use the above combinations to set the perfect mood. They will help you to create a winter wonderland your guests will remember for years to come. Winter wedding colors not only look good in winter, they can be used in the other seasons of the year. Choose a color that will make you happy and make your wedding guests stop and stare.
